NRW is a German proper noun that means North Rhine-Westphalia. It is pronounced /ɛnʔɛʁˈveː/.

Definitions

1.Abbreviation for das Bundesland Nordrhein-Westfalen in west Germany(geography, German federal states)

a.Germany's most populous federal state

Das Wirtschaftswachstum in NRW ist sehr wichtig für Deutschland.Economic growth in NRW is very important for Germany.

b.the government/authorities of North Rhine-Westphalia

NRW plant strengere Umweltauflagen für Unternehmen.NRW is planning stricter environmental regulations for companies.
